Output fe8d5fdbecff0dc28d0e72f7c04d912e66ea75b6961fa5ee735b11fbf662b35e:1

value
13412530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e66b17a06c5b4ff1cb2a40eac8fdac80790fc3e OP_EQUAL
address
3DDN5y5mmRmHBusrbiuddimBV8Xs1gCdWF
transaction
fe8d5fdbecff0dc28d0e72f7c04d912e66ea75b6961fa5ee735b11fbf662b35e
confirmations
454751
spent
true